[Bug 2083908] Re: [SRU] pymodbus 3.6.9-1 from 24.10 (to 24.04)

Talha Can Havadar 2083908 at bugs.launchpad.net
Wed Mar 26 12:45:27 UTC 2025


Hey all,

Tests are green see below:
```
* Results:
  - pymodbus: noble/pymodbus/3.6.9-1ubuntu0.24.04.1 [amd64]
    + ✅ pymodbus on noble for amd64   @ 26.03.25 08:00:31
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/amd64/p/pymodbus/20250326_080031_8e3bb@/log.gz
    + ✅ pymodbus on noble for amd64   @ 26.03.25 08:02:36
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/amd64/p/pymodbus/20250326_080236_7f2bf@/log.gz
  - pymodbus: noble/pymodbus/3.6.9-1ubuntu0.24.04.1 [arm64]
    + ✅ pymodbus on noble for arm64   @ 26.03.25 08:01:14
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/arm64/p/pymodbus/20250326_080114_522fa@/log.gz
    + ✅ pymodbus on noble for arm64   @ 26.03.25 08:04:28
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/arm64/p/pymodbus/20250326_080428_980c5@/log.gz
  - pymodbus: noble/pymodbus/3.6.9-1ubuntu0.24.04.1 [armhf]
    + ✅ pymodbus on noble for armhf   @ 26.03.25 08:01:34
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/armhf/p/pymodbus/20250326_080134_ac3d6@/log.gz
    + ✅ pymodbus on noble for armhf   @ 26.03.25 08:02:13
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/armhf/p/pymodbus/20250326_080213_b403c@/log.gz
  - pymodbus: noble/pymodbus/3.6.9-1ubuntu0.24.04.1 [i386]
    + ✅ pymodbus on noble for i386    @ 26.03.25 08:00:59
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/i386/p/pymodbus/20250326_080059_83150@/log.gz
    + ✅ pymodbus on noble for i386    @ 26.03.25 08:02:30
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/i386/p/pymodbus/20250326_080230_4eac1@/log.gz
  - pymodbus: noble/pymodbus/3.6.9-1ubuntu0.24.04.1 [ppc64el]
    + ✅ pymodbus on noble for ppc64el @ 26.03.25 08:01:23
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/ppc64el/p/pymodbus/20250326_080123_72f00@/log.gz
    + ✅ pymodbus on noble for ppc64el @ 26.03.25 08:18:37
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/ppc64el/p/pymodbus/20250326_081837_e6262@/log.gz
  - pymodbus: noble/pymodbus/3.6.9-1ubuntu0.24.04.1 [s390x]
    + ✅ pymodbus on noble for s390x   @ 26.03.25 08:00:52
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/s390x/p/pymodbus/20250326_080052_a0204@/log.gz
    + ✅ pymodbus on noble for s390x   @ 26.03.25 08:01:43
      • Log: https://autopkgtest.ubuntu.com/results/autopkgtest-noble-tchavadar-lp2083908-test2/noble/s390x/p/pymodbus/20250326_080143_32ed4@/log.gz
* Running: (none)
```

-- 
You received this bug notification because you are a member of Ubuntu
Sponsors, which is subscribed to the bug report.
https://bugs.launchpad.net/bugs/2083908

Title:
  [SRU] pymodbus 3.6.9-1 from 24.10 (to 24.04)

Status in pymodbus package in Ubuntu:
  Invalid
Status in pymodbus source package in Noble:
  New

Bug description:
  Pymodbus 3.6.9 has Python 3.12 support and is available in oracular.
  Is it possible to have a release of pymodbus in noble ?

  ---

  [Impact]

   * There is no pymodbus available in 24.04, its useful for many
  projects to have it and given that 24.04 is an LTS it seems justified
  to backport the 24.10 version of pymodbus to 24.04.

   * Community members as well as commercial partners have asked to get
  pymodbus back in 24.04.

  [Test Plan]

   * Make sure autopkgtests passes
   * Package needs to be tested for certain use cases on real hardware, we will be able to test it with AMD/Xilinx Kria devices

  [Where problems could occur]

   * Package was present in jammy so for the users upgraded from jammy to noble
     they may still have the version of this package in Jammy, and this is a major
     version change which is highly likely for the users of this package to
     introduce breaking changes

  [Other Info]

   * pymodbus is available in focal/jammy as well as in oracular/plucky

   * pymodbus jumps from 2.x to 3.x between 22.04 to 24.04 which means
  some API changes. But I guess that is better than having no pymodbus
  at all.

   * getting pymodbus back into 24.04 will probably also help to avoid distortion
     and some confusion for users who upgrade from earlier versions,
     where the package is still available (focal/jammy),
     but not getting it for 24.04 anymore,
     but again with oracular (and newer).

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/pymodbus/+bug/2083908/+subscriptions





More information about the Ubuntu-sponsors mailing list